Gerbillus amoenus (de Winton, 1902) View in CoL . Ann. Mag. Nat. Hist., ser. 7, 9:46.

TYPE LOCALITY: Egypt, Giza Prov .

DISTRIBUTION: Recorded only from Egypt and Libya.

COMMENTS: Lay (1983) speculated that the species may range across Tunisia and Algeria to Mauritania, noted its past associations with dasyurus and campestris , and advised future comparison with G. nanus . Ranck (1968) reviewed the Libyan populations and recorded significant geographic variation.
